What does it mean when the result of solving a linear equation is x = 0?

If you solve a linear equation in one variable, "x=0" tells you that substituting 0 for x makes the equation true.

When it comes to sampling methods, random sampling is one of the most effective. The principal wants the results of his or her sample to be as fair as possible, so it is best to choose students randomly, and in a neutral environment. The mall is not a neutral environment because not all students have access to the mall, and even those who do are not guaranteed to provide accurate results. The same goes for a basketball game, and student council. Samples taken from these environments are likely to produce more bias. However, collecting a survey from every tenth student entering the school one morning is more likely to produce accurate results that are representative of the school population.
